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Goldman's Nectar Bat | Triangulate Bud Spider |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Arachnida (Arachnids)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Araneae (Araneae) |
| Family | Phyllostomidae | Theridiidae |
| Genus | Lonchophylla | Steatoda |
| Species | Lonchophylla mordax | Steatoda triangulosa |
